Stefan Uroš V of Serbia

Saint Stefan Uroš V Nejaki ("The Weak"; Serbian: Свети Стефан Урош V Нејаки; 1336 – 2/4 December 1371) was king of the Serbian Empire (1346–1355) as co-regent of his father Stefan Uroš IV Dušan Silni ("The Mighty") and then Emperor (tsar) (1355–1371). Stefan Uroš V was the only son of Stefan Uroš IV Dušan by Helena of Bulgaria, the sister of Ivan Alexander of Bulgaria.
